Product Information
When the TB-303 Bass Line synthesizer was released in 1981, it was meant to be a substitute for bass guitars. Its sound was subsequently deemed unrealistic by users, and it was discontinued 3 years later - but when it found its way into the hands of electronic music producers in the late ‘80s, the 303 emerged as something entirely different.
Acid V channels the cult-classic bass synth that pushed the underground into overdrive. Pump your mixes full of reactive ever-evolving bass grooves, unleash mutated sequences fizzing with distortion, and experiment with extra features for revitalized rave energy.
Featuring:
- Analog oscillator with Square and Triangle waveforms
- 3 multi-mode function generators for flexible modulation
- 4 FX slots with 17 FX to choose from
- Over 150 factory presets
- Advanced polymetric sequencer & arpeggiator
- Built-in distortion module with 14 algorithms
- Hidden hatch for fine-tuning & customizing analog components
- Resonant low-pass filter & Added vibrato feature
- See the full features list on Arturia's website here
Compatible with macOS and Windows.
Available as AAX, AU, VST, and VST3.
